scarce /skeǝs/ adj (-er , -est )
ရှားပါးသော။ scarce resources ❍ Money/ Labour was scarce. ❍ Food soon became scarcer and more expensive. Compare PLENTIFUL ❍ RARE
❏ make oneself scarce [IDM ] (infml )
အသာလစ် ထွက်ပြေးသည်။ ရှောင်ပေးသည်။
I could tell they wanted to be left alone so I made myself scarce.
❏ scarcity /'skeǝsǝti/ n [C,U] ရှားပါးမှု။ frequent scarcities of raw materials ❍ The scarcity of food forced prices up.
